Exploring Oracle Jobs in India

Oracle is a popular and in-demand skill in the Indian job market, with numerous opportunities available for professionals with expertise in Oracle technologies. Whether you are a seasoned Oracle developer or just starting your career in this field, there are plenty of job openings waiting for you in various industries across India.

Top Hiring Locations in India

If you are considering a career in Oracle, here are the top 5 cities in India where you can find active hiring for Oracle roles: 1. Bangalore 2. Hyderabad 3. Pune 4. Chennai 5. Mumbai

Average Salary Range

The salary range for Oracle professionals in India varies based on experience and expertise. On average, entry-level Oracle developers can expect to earn between INR 4-6 lakhs per annum, while experienced Oracle consultants and architects can command salaries upwards of INR 15 lakhs per annum.

Career Path

In the field of Oracle, a typical career progression may look like this: - Junior Oracle Developer - Oracle Developer - Senior Oracle Developer - Oracle Technical Lead - Oracle Architect

Related Skills

In addition to Oracle expertise, professionals in this field are often expected to have knowledge or experience in the following areas: - SQL - PL/SQL - Database design - Data modeling - Performance tuning
